diff options
author | nutti <nutti.metro@gmail.com> | 2020-08-10 10:07:26 +0300 |
---|---|---|
committer | nutti <nutti.metro@gmail.com> | 2020-08-10 10:24:28 +0300 |
commit | 8db46434a4b25569372a7172f83733ec14dffb31 (patch) | |
tree | f981b15847246b0ffb054cc4d87083b2ec394fda /magic_uv/ui/VIEW3D_MT_uv_map.py | |
parent | 7084d19ef5886b740b65ba6a4234849859e0e5b8 (diff) |
Magic UV: Release v6.3
Added features
- Clip UV
Updated features
- World Scale UV
* Add option "Area Calculation Method"
* Add option "Only Selected"
- UVW
* Support multiple objects
- Select UV
* Support multiple objects
- UV Inspection
* Add Paint UV Island feature
* Support multiple objects
Other updates
- Fix bugs
- Optimization
Diffstat (limited to 'magic_uv/ui/VIEW3D_MT_uv_map.py')
-rw-r--r-- | magic_uv/ui/VIEW3D_MT_uv_map.py | 17 |
1 files changed, 9 insertions, 8 deletions
diff --git a/magic_uv/ui/VIEW3D_MT_uv_map.py b/magic_uv/ui/VIEW3D_MT_uv_map.py index 853d1855..7ab50ace 100644 --- a/magic_uv/ui/VIEW3D_MT_uv_map.py +++ b/magic_uv/ui/VIEW3D_MT_uv_map.py @@ -20,8 +20,8 @@ __author__ = "Nutti <nutti.metro@gmail.com>" __status__ = "production" -__version__ = "6.2" -__date__ = "31 Jul 2019" +__version__ = "6.3" +__date__ = "10 Aug 2020" import bpy.utils @@ -147,24 +147,25 @@ class MUV_MT_WorldScaleUV(bpy.types.Menu): layout = self.layout sc = context.scene - layout.operator(MUV_OT_WorldScaleUV_Measure.bl_idname, - text="Measure") + layout.operator(MUV_OT_WorldScaleUV_Measure.bl_idname, text="Measure") - layout.operator(MUV_OT_WorldScaleUV_ApplyManual.bl_idname, - text="Apply (Manual)") + ops = layout.operator(MUV_OT_WorldScaleUV_ApplyManual.bl_idname, + text="Apply (Manual)") + ops.show_dialog = True ops = layout.operator( MUV_OT_WorldScaleUV_ApplyScalingDensity.bl_idname, text="Apply (Same Desity)") ops.src_density = sc.muv_world_scale_uv_src_density ops.same_density = True + ops.show_dialog = True ops = layout.operator( MUV_OT_WorldScaleUV_ApplyScalingDensity.bl_idname, text="Apply (Scaling Desity)") ops.src_density = sc.muv_world_scale_uv_src_density ops.same_density = False - ops.tgt_scaling_factor = sc.muv_world_scale_uv_tgt_scaling_factor + ops.show_dialog = True ops = layout.operator( MUV_OT_WorldScaleUV_ApplyProportionalToMesh.bl_idname, @@ -172,7 +173,7 @@ class MUV_MT_WorldScaleUV(bpy.types.Menu): ops.src_density = sc.muv_world_scale_uv_src_density ops.src_uv_area = sc.muv_world_scale_uv_src_uv_area ops.src_mesh_area = sc.muv_world_scale_uv_src_mesh_area - ops.origin = sc.muv_world_scale_uv_origin + ops.show_dialog = True @BlClassRegistry() |